in Pakistan, Faisalabad Anti Terrorist Court No 1 judge Raja Muhammad Arshad sentenced Nasir Iqbal to death for setting his wife Sobia and daughter Kashfa, 10, on fire on April 19, 2011, causing their deaths. The Ghulam Muhammadabad Christian Chowk resident had accused his wife of cheating with their neighbour. The court has also fined him Rs200,000.
